Two new Firms Froms Gran Canaria

15/09/2022

Ogadenia Couture and Como la trucha al trucho join the advisory program that the Asociación de Creadores de Moda de España offers to selected firms from Gran Canaria Moda Cálida. A collaboration agreement that both institutions established in 2018 and due to which nine firms from Gran Canaria receive ACME’s professional services.

Their adhesion to this program became effective in a meeting held at the Association’s headquarters, in which the Councillor of Industry of the Cabildo de Gran Canaria, Minerva Alonso; Araceli Díaz Santana, director of Gran Canaria Moda Cálida; Modesto Lomba, president of ACME, and Modesto Lomba,, executive director of ACME also participated.

Right now creators Arcadio Domínguez, Blasón, Aurelia Gil, Chela Clo, Lucas Balboa, Elena Morales, Susana Requena, Pedro Palmas and Gonzales are benefiting from this agreement, being joined by Ogadenia Couture and Como la trucha al trucho. It is about facilitating non-permanent aid, as the Councillor explained during this meeting. This collaboration with ACME is intended to serve as a launching pad for firms from Gran Canaria. For the selection of the brands that are incorporated, a report made by the Association itself is taken into account, as well as that the selected designers have the necessary instruments to market outside the Canary Islands.

Of Ogadenia Couture 2022, it is worth highlighting their commitment to artisan work, which is manifested in the variety of hand-embroidered fabrics on looms that are the protagonists of their collections, whose essence is sensuality and femininity.

In the case of the swimwear company Como la trucha al trucho, its 2022 collection, called ‘Damajuana‘, was inspired by women with a Mediterranean and adventurous character, with a series of comfortable and versatile pieces which are the swimwear brand’s hallmark.
